The deadline to file your tax returns is fast approaching.
Every spring, the Canada Revenue Agency holds volunteer tax preparation clinics for those with modest incomes who need some help.
CRA spokesperson Desmond Arseneault says volunteers are able to fill out basic tax returns.
“Training sessions put on by the Canada Revenue Agency are very thorough and detailed. I wouldn’t say rigorous but it does provide sample information and enough knowledge for the volunteers to be able to feel comfortable in preparing these returns,” he says.
The clinics are free and are hosted by various community organizations such as public libraries or Royal Canadian Legion branches.
